开源数据库工具DBeaver:你的数据库管理利器
开源数据库工具DBeaver:你的数据库管理利器
在当今数据驱动的世界中,数据库管理工具的重要性不言而喻。选择一款合适的工具可以极大地提高开发效率,简化数据库操作,并有效地管理数据。DBeaver,作为一个功能强大且开源的数据库管理平台,正是这样一款利器。它支持几乎所有主流的数据库类型,提供丰富的功能和友好的用户界面,成为众多开发者和数据库管理员的首选。
本文将深入探讨DBeaver的功能、优势以及使用方法,帮助你全面了解这款优秀的数据库管理工具。
一、 DBeaver:功能全面的数据库瑞士军刀
DBeaver不仅仅是一个简单的数据库客户端,它更像是一个集成的数据库管理平台,提供了一系列丰富的功能,涵盖了数据库连接、数据浏览、SQL编辑、数据导入导出、数据库管理等各个方面。
-
广泛的数据库支持: DBeaver支持几乎所有流行的关系型数据库,包括MySQL, PostgreSQL, Oracle, SQL Server, DB2, MariaDB等,同时也支持NoSQL数据库,例如MongoDB, Cassandra, Redis等。这种广泛的支持使得用户可以使用同一个工具管理不同的数据库,极大地简化了工作流程。
-
直观友好的用户界面: DBeaver拥有简洁直观的用户界面,即使是初学者也能快速上手。它提供了各种视图和面板,方便用户浏览数据库对象、执行SQL查询、查看数据以及管理数据库连接。
-
强大的SQL编辑器: DBeaver内置了功能强大的SQL编辑器,支持语法高亮、代码补全、自动格式化等功能,极大地提高了SQL编写效率。它还支持多种SQL方言,并可以根据数据库类型自动调整语法提示。
-
数据浏览和编辑: DBeaver提供了多种数据浏览和编辑方式,包括表格视图、文本视图、卡片视图等。用户可以根据需要选择合适的视图,方便地查看和编辑数据。它还支持数据过滤、排序、分组等功能,方便用户快速定位所需数据。
-
数据导入导出: DBeaver支持多种数据导入导出格式,例如CSV, Excel, XML, JSON等。用户可以方便地将数据导入到数据库中,或者将数据库中的数据导出到其他格式的文件中。
-
数据库管理: DBeaver提供了丰富的数据库管理功能,例如创建和删除数据库、创建和修改表、管理用户和权限等。它还支持数据库迁移和备份,方便用户进行数据库维护和管理。
-
插件扩展: DBeaver支持插件扩展,用户可以根据需要安装各种插件来增强DBeaver的功能,例如版本控制插件、数据可视化插件等。
-
跨平台支持: DBeaver支持Windows, macOS和Linux等多个操作系统,用户可以在不同的平台上使用相同的工具,保持一致的工作体验。
二、 DBeaver的优势:为何选择它?
DBeaver的诸多优势使其成为众多开发者和数据库管理员的理想选择:
-
开源免费: DBeaver是一个开源项目,用户可以免费使用和修改其代码。这使得DBeaver成为一个经济实惠的选择,尤其对于个人开发者和小型团队来说。
-
社区支持: DBeaver拥有活跃的社区,用户可以在社区中寻求帮助、分享经验以及提交bug报告。这使得DBeaver能够不断改进和完善。
-
轻量级: DBeaver的安装包相对较小,安装和启动速度都很快,不会占用过多的系统资源。
-
高度可定制: DBeaver提供了丰富的配置选项,用户可以根据自己的需求定制DBeaver的外观和行为。
-
安全性: DBeaver支持多种安全连接方式,例如SSL/TLS加密,确保数据库连接的安全性。
三、 DBeaver的使用:快速上手指南
DBeaver的使用非常简单,以下是简单的上手指南:
-
下载和安装: 从DBeaver官网下载对应操作系统的安装包,并按照提示进行安装。
-
创建数据库连接: 启动DBeaver后,点击“新建连接”按钮,选择要连接的数据库类型,并填写连接信息,例如主机地址、端口号、用户名和密码等。
-
浏览数据库对象: 连接成功后,可以在左侧的导航面板中浏览数据库对象,例如数据库、表、视图、存储过程等。
-
执行SQL查询: 在SQL编辑器中编写SQL查询语句,并点击“执行”按钮,即可查看查询结果。
-
数据编辑: 在数据浏览视图中,可以直接编辑数据,并保存修改。
-
数据导入导出: 使用数据导入导出功能,将数据导入到数据库中,或者将数据库中的数据导出到文件中。
四、 DBeaver与其他数据库工具的比较
与其他数据库工具相比,DBeaver具有以下优势:
-
与DataGrip相比: DataGrip是JetBrains开发的一款商业数据库工具,功能强大但价格昂贵。DBeaver作为开源免费的替代品,提供了类似的功能,并且更加经济实惠。
-
与SQL Developer相比: SQL Developer是Oracle官方提供的数据库工具,主要用于Oracle数据库。DBeaver支持更多的数据库类型,并且跨平台支持更好。
-
与phpMyAdmin相比: phpMyAdmin是一款基于Web的MySQL管理工具,功能相对简单。DBeaver提供更丰富的功能和更友好的用户界面。
五、 总结:DBeaver,值得信赖的数据库管理利器
DBeaver以其强大的功能、友好的界面、开源免费的特性以及广泛的数据库支持,成为众多开发者和数据库管理员的首选工具。它不仅简化了数据库操作,提高了工作效率,还降低了数据库管理的成本。无论是个人开发者还是大型企业,DBeaver都是一个值得信赖的数据库管理利器。 它持续的社区支持和不断更新的功能也保证了它在未来能够持续满足用户不断变化的需求。 如果你正在寻找一款功能强大、易于使用且经济实惠的数据库管理工具,DBeaver绝对值得一试。 相信通过本文的介绍,你已经对DBeaver有了更深入的了解,并能够更好地利用它来管理你的数据库。